But let’s back up. The mere idea of writing a memoir can be wrought with emotion. Do you really want to revisit–or dig in–to the past? The answer to that lies with in you. But I promise you, unlocking your memories and delving into your history will be life-changing.

There are so many reasons to write a memoir:

  • to share your story with friends and family
  • to heal
  • for catharsis
  • to connect with people
  • to share history you’ve been part of
  • to reveal a truth
